🛕 Top 20 Temples in India

1. Kashi Vishwanath Temple (Varanasi, Uttar Pradesh)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Shiva
  • One of the 12 Jyotirlingas and one of the holiest Hindu temples.

2. Tirumala Venkateswara Temple (Tirupati, Andhra Pradesh)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Venkateswara (Vishnu)
  • Among the richest and most visited temples in the world.

3. Meenakshi Temple (Madurai, Tamil Nadu)

  • Dedicated to: Goddess Meenakshi (Parvati) and Lord Sundareshwar (Shiva)
  • Famous for its stunning Dravidian architecture.

4. Somnath Temple (Gujarat)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Shiva
  • One of the 12 Jyotirlingas and historically important.

5. Brihadeeswarar Temple (Thanjavur, Tamil Nadu)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Shiva
  • UNESCO World Heritage Site, built by Raja Raja Chola I.

6. Golden Temple (Harmandir Sahib, Amritsar, Punjab)

  • Sikh Temple (Gurudwara)
  • Known for its gold-covered sanctum and langar (community kitchen).

7. Jagannath Temple (Puri, Odisha)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Jagannath (Vishnu)
  • Famous for the annual Rath Yatra festival.

8. Kedarnath Temple (Uttarakhand)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Shiva
  • Part of the Char Dham and Panch Kedar pilgrimage.

9. Vaishno Devi Temple (Jammu & Kashmir)

  • Dedicated to: Goddess Vaishno Devi
  • Located in the Trikuta Mountains; major pilgrimage site.

10. Ramanathaswamy Temple (Rameswaram, Tamil Nadu)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Shiva
  • Part of the Char Dham; famous for its long corridors.

11. Akshardham Temple (Delhi)

  • Dedicated to: Swaminarayan
  • Modern temple with stunning architecture and exhibitions.

12. Mahabodhi Temple (Bodh Gaya, Bihar)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Buddha
  • UNESCO World Heritage Site; site of Buddha’s enlightenment.

13. Siddhivinayak Temple (Mumbai, Maharashtra)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Ganesha
  • Highly revered and visited by celebrities and politicians.

14. Amarnath Cave Temple (Jammu & Kashmir)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Shiva
  • Famous for the ice Shiva Lingam and the annual Yatra.

15. Lingaraj Temple (Bhubaneswar, Odisha)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Shiva
  • Architectural marvel of the Kalinga style.

16. Yamunotri Temple (Uttarakhand)

  • Dedicated to: Goddess Yamuna
  • Starting point of the Char Dham Yatra.

17. Gangotri Temple (Uttarakhand)

  • Dedicated to: Goddess Ganga
  • Source of the sacred Ganges River.

18. Dwarkadhish Temple (Dwarka, Gujarat)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Krishna
  • Part of the Char Dham; historical kingdom of Krishna.

19. Sri Ranganathaswamy Temple (Srirangam, Tamil Nadu)

  • Dedicated to: Lord Ranganatha (Vishnu)
  • Largest functioning temple complex in India.

20. Kamakhya Temple (Guwahati, Assam)

  • Dedicated to: Goddess Kamakhya (Shakti)
  • Important Shakti Peetha and Tantric worship center.
